After extensive testing, both to understand how light sensors output power and the power needed to light a lamp (1), this works as intended, just not as you (or I) were expecting. At high noon a sensor outputs a value of 16, while inverted outputs 0. Somewhere in the middle, say at sunset, the output becomes the same whether inverted or not, and since the lamp only requires one power unit to light, it appears to be unaffected by the inversion.
